Damian Czykier (pronounced [ˈdam.jan ˈt͡ʂɨ.kjɛr]; born 10 August 1992) is a Polish athlete specialising in the high hurdles.[3] He came fourth at the 2015 Summer Universiade and the 2016 European Championships.

His personal bests are 13.28 seconds in the 110 metres hurdles (+1.2 m/s, Bydgoszcz 2017) and 7.65 seconds in the 60 metres hurdles (Belgrade 2017). Both of his parents are former athletes; father Dariusz Czykier was a footballer while mother Elżbieta Stankiewicz a basketball player.[4]
